The Mummy
Sofia Boutella, CinemaCon’s Female Star of Tomorrow, was joined on-stage with her co-stars, Tom Cruise, Annabelle Wallis, Jake Johnson and director, Alex Kurztman. The remake is Universal’s tribute to the legendary monster film. In the movie, there is a zero-gravity scene that took 64 takes, two days, four flights and A LOT of puke bags to capture (that’s icky and awesome). Tom explained that he wanted the scene to be captured in real-time and functionality, not on green screen. We say, cheers to bringing that authenticity to the audience Tom! Universal is excited to go beyond the theatre with this film and will be displaying a VR (virtual reality) demonstration of the free-falling scene during CinemaCon. Since we can’t bring that to life for you, the trailer will have to do. The Mummy opens on June 9.

Atomic Blonde
Atomic Blonde is an R-rated, wildly entertaining, spy, action thriller set in the cold war. Starring Academy Award winner, Charlize Theron, the film is based on the graphic novel about a M16 agent dragged into double/triple espionage. When director David Leitch spoke about Charlize Theron, he said she trained for three hours for three months so the action would look REAL, “She has an aptitude for action scenes.” Theron chimed in with, “we worked our b*lls off!” One key highlight from the upcoming film is the 10-minute fight scene which Theron described as “thrilling, exhausting and straight kick-butt!” Atomic Blonde also stars Sofia Boutella, James McAvoy and John Goodman. It opens on July 28.
